This commit is causing segfaults in > the case where this Git command does not load delta islands at all, e.g. > when reading object IDs from standard input. One such crash can be hit > when using repacking multi-pack-indices with delta islands enabled. > > The root cause of this bug is that we unconditionally dereference the > `island_marks` variable even in the case where it is a `NULL` pointer, > which is fixed by making it conditional. Note that we still leave the > logic in place to set the pointer to `-1` to detect use-after-free bugs > even when there are no loaded island marks at all. Oops, my fault :x Thanks for this fix.
